ABSTRACT:
This White Paper is designed for those who are interested understanding the role a well-defined Web-use policy can play in your organization, and the inherent need for a robust Web-use reporting tool. The paper covers many important reasons your organization should be diligent in defining a Web-use policy and why the ability to capture details about Internet and e-mail activities is critical.
The Sarbanes-Oxley Act (SOA),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) and Children's Internet Protection Act (CIPA) have all made Web-use policies and related reporting systems 'must-haves' in today's corporate, healthcare, education and government environments. This White Paper also examines the different types of Web- reporting tools that are available.
